A leading education provider in the UK is seeking Examiners for GCSE History. This role provides a valuable opportunity for early career and experienced teachers to enhance their knowledge of the assessment cycle.
Responsibilities include:
- Marking scripts accurately
- Meeting deadlines
- Submitting samples
Candidates must have a degree, be qualified teachers, and be in their ECT year. Marking can be done from home using ePEN, with training provided prior to the marking period. This position offers a flexible working environment from May to July.
